Michigan law requires organizations to register with the Department of Attorney General if they solicit and receive charitable contributions in Michigan. Most charities that solicit contributions in Michigan are required to file one.

Most states regulate fundraising to protect the public, corporations and any potential donors from fraudulent solicitation. Many charitable organizations must register with the state, and individual fundraising professionals must hold a license before they may fundraise.
